1. Lone Star Saloon
Lone Star Saloon is a quintessential American bar and grill that brings a slice of Texas right to the heart of Phnom Penh. This establishment is renowned for its hearty portions and authentic flavors, making it a favorite among those who appreciate good, old-fashioned American comfort food. The menu is packed with Southern staples like BBQ ribs, chicken fried steak, and a variety of burgers that are sure to satisfy any craving.
The ambiance at Lone Star Saloon is laid-back and rustic, perfect for enjoying a cold beer with friends while watching a game on TV or listening to live music. The décor, featuring wooden furnishings and Texas memorabilia, adds to the overall cozy, welcoming vibe.
Signature Dishes: BBQ Ribs, Chicken Fried Steak, Cheeseburgers.
Operating Hours:
Monday to Sunday: 7:00 AM – 11:00 PM
Address: Street 23, Phnom Penh
2. Brooklyn Pizza + Bistro
Brooklyn Pizza + Bistro is a top choice for those seeking American-style pizzas and classic bistro fare in Phnom Penh. Situated in the lively Toul Tom Poung neighborhood, this restaurant is known for its high-quality ingredients and commitment to delivering a true New York dining experience.
The menu offers a wide variety of options, including New York-style pizzas, burgers, sandwiches, and pasta dishes, all crafted with a New York twist. The interior boasts an industrial-chic design, with exposed brick walls and modern lighting, creating a stylish yet casual dining environment. The friendly staff and welcoming atmosphere make Brooklyn Pizza + Bistro a favorite hangout spot for both locals and expats.
Signature Dishes: New York-style Pizza, Philly Cheesesteak, Buffalo Wings.
Operating Hours:
Monday to Sunday: 11:00 AM – 10:00 PM
Address: 20 Street 123, Toul Tom Poung, Phnom Penh
3. Mike’s Burger House
If you’re on the hunt for the best burgers in Phnom Penh, look no further than Mike’s Burger House. This popular eatery is known for its juicy, American-style burgers, which are made with fresh ingredients and packed with flavor. The menu also features a variety of classic American fast food items, including hot dogs, chili cheese fries, and thick, creamy milkshakes.
Mike’s Burger House exudes a retro diner vibe, complete with checkered floors and nostalgic décor. The friendly service and casual atmosphere make it a great spot for a quick, satisfying meal or a relaxed hangout with friends.
Signature Dishes: Classic Cheeseburger, Chili Cheese Fries, Milkshakes.
Operating Hours:
Monday to Sunday: 10:00 AM – 10:00 PM
Address: 26 Street 242, Phnom Penh
4. The Exchange
For a more upscale American dining experience in Phnom Penh, The Exchange is the place to be. Housed in a beautifully restored colonial building, The Exchange offers a sophisticated atmosphere perfect for both business lunches and romantic dinners. The menu features gourmet versions of American classics, including steaks, ribs, and seafood dishes, all prepared with the finest ingredients and an artistic touch.
The restaurant’s elegant interior, with its high ceilings and stylish décor, provides a refined dining environment. Additionally, the outdoor garden area is a popular spot for enjoying a leisurely weekend brunch or evening cocktails.
Signature Dishes: Ribeye Steak, BBQ Pork Ribs, Seafood Platter.
Operating Hours:
Monday to Sunday: 11:00 AM – 11:00 PM
Address: No. 28 Street 47, Sangkat Wat Phnom, Phnom Penh
5. Harry’s Bar and Grill
Harry’s Bar and Grill is a laid-back American restaurant that offers a warm and welcoming atmosphere along Phnom Penh’s iconic riverfront. Known for its Southern hospitality and comforting American dishes, Harry’s is a go-to spot for both locals and tourists. The menu features a variety of favorites, including fried chicken, baby back ribs, and Southern-style burgers, all served with a smile.
The restaurant’s relaxed setting, complete with classic American music and sports broadcasts on TV, makes it an ideal place for a casual meal with friends or family. The scenic river views only add to the appeal, making Harry’s a popular destination any time of day.
Signature Dishes: Fried Chicken, Baby Back Ribs, Southern-style Burgers.
Operating Hours:
Monday to Sunday: 7:00 AM – 12:00 AM
Address: #219, st:, Preah Sisowath Quay, Cambodia
